Daniel Kehler

In April of 2022, Daniel Kehler was hired as the head coach of the Montreat College men’s and women’s golf programs. Kehler coached the Cavaliers for three seasons through February of 2025.

YEAR-BY-YEAR HIGHLIGHTS

2024-25 (Men's Golf)
  • Coached Alex Murphy to a fifth-place individual finish at the AAC Fall Preview (Oct. 28-29).
  • Athlete achievements: 1 Second Team All-AAC, 3 AAC All-Academic Team members.
2023-24 (Women's Golf)
  • Finished runner-up at the Fincastle Intercollegiate, marking the program's first runner-up finish at a tournament with three or more teams since 2019.
  • Athlete achievements: 2 CSC Academic All-District® At-Large Team honorees, 3 Daktronics NAIA Scholar-Athletes, 4 AAC All-Academic Team members.
2023-24 (Men's Golf)
  • Finished 9th of 13 teams at AAC Direct Qualifier.
  • Athlete achievements: 1 AAC Golfer of the Week, 1 AAC All-Academic Team.
2023-24 (Women's Golf)
  • Finished 8th of 8 teams at AAC Direct Qualifier.
  • Athlete achievements: 1 CSC Academic All-District Women's At-Large Team, 2 Daktronics NAIA Scholar-Athletes, 1 AAC All-Academic Team.
2022-23 (Men's Golf)
  • Finished 10th of 13 teams at AAC Direct Qualifier.
  • Athlete achievements: 1 AAC Golfer of the Week, 1 AAC All-Academic Team.
2022-23 (Women's Golf)
  • Finished 9th of 9 teams at AAC Direct Qualifier.

PRIOR TO MONTREAT
 
Kehler, who was a student-athlete with the Cavaliers during his undergraduate education, returned to Montreat in the role of head coach. The Marion, N.C. native spent four seasons competing as a member of the men’s golf team, while also contributing regularly as a men’s basketball athlete.
 
Kehler lives in the Marion, N.C. area with his wife, Hayley.
